    Has anyone came across a hdb containing tables with sym columns, but unenumerated?

    I know enumeration has a lot of benefits, but is there a way to leave a table as it is, with the sym columns unenumerated even if that is causing an increase in disk space used?

    It’s not only the disk space, performance will suffer. I guess this is why there is no trivial way to create such table (but it is possible).
    Why do you want to spare the sym file?

      I have a client who wants to pull hdb partitions and mix them up with their own hdb.
      They don’t want to reenumerate every single time. They just want to be able to copy some tables in their partition, fill the rest of partitions with empty schemas and have it work that way.
